Job Description / Duties

This is an at-will exempt intermittent position which can be terminated at any time without cause. A Special Program Assistant II (Custodial) will perform a variety of cleaning and janitorial tasks in Zoo facilities and around Zoo grounds. Primary duties include, but are not limited to:

  • Cleaning tiles, floors, stairways, hallways, and restrooms
  • Cleaning, dusting, and/or polishing office furniture
  • Replenishing restroom supplies
  • Cleaning, washing, and polishing windows, hand railings, elevators, and door hardware
  • Emptying wastebaskets and trash cans
  • Moving and arranging chairs, tables, appliances, and other furniture and miscellaneous objects for scheduled activities
  • Replacing electric light globes and fluorescent lamps
  • Picking debris
  • Assisting in the sweeping and washing of cement walkways and other areas
  • Some duties may be outdoors and may be exposed to the sun and heat for a prolonged period of time
